Marine Lines: Discovering Hidden Communities

Disembarking at Marine Lines, you’ll encounter a part of Mumbai that’s often overlooked by visitors. Here, your guide might introduce you to the Parsi community, sharing stories of Persian families that arrived over a century ago. Expect to sample slow-cooked kheema with freshly baked bread or other regional specialties. Multiple reviews mention this as a “highlight,” with one saying, “we reveal stories behind some of the last remaining Parsi communities in the city.”

Zaveri Bazaar: Street Food in the Heart of the Market

Next, the tour moves into the buzzing alleyways of Zaveri Bazaar, known for its jewelry shops but also a street food haven. You’ll indulge in crispy masala papads, chutney-spiked pudla, cheese-loaded dosas, and sweet treats like moongdal halwa. Reviewers rave about how these stalls have been feeding locals for decades, with some saying it’s “no lunch needed” after sampling so many snacks.

Mangaldas Market: Local Life and More Tasting

The final stretch takes you through Mangaldas Market, where you’ll witness everyday Mumbai life. Here, you can try buttery aubergine curry, freshly baked chapatis, and enjoy the lively atmosphere of a busy local market. Reviewers like Annalisa highlight that this part of the tour offers a glimpse into how Mumbai residents live, shop, and eat—something most travelers never get to see.
